A stainless steel etcher is a specialized tool used in metalworking to create intricate and precise designs on stainless steel surfaces. This tool uses a combination of chemicals and electrical currents to etch patterns onto the metal, resulting in a permanent and durable design. stainless steel etchers are commonly used in industries such as jewelry making, electronics manufacturing, and automotive production.
